WebHypertrophic scars that result from burn wounds are more difficult to treat. Superficial burn wounds usually heal without forming hypertrophic scars. Deep burn wounds are harder to treat. Many dermatologic and plastic surgeons treat these by removing the burned area and then using a skin graft.

WebHypertrophic Scar. A hypertrophic scar is a thick raised scar that’s an abnormal response to wound healing.
